Overview
The HUANKONG GHK-4300B Portable Multicomponent Gas Analyzer is an engineered field-deployable instrument designed for real-time, on-site quantification of up to 24 hazardous and regulated gaseous compounds in ambient air. It integrates multiple detection technologies—including electrochemical cells for toxic gases (e.g., CO, H₂S, NO₂, Cl₂, NH₃), non-dispersive infrared (NDIR) for CO₂ and hydrocarbons, catalytic bead (pellistor) sensors for combustible gases (e.g., CH₄, C₃H₈), and photoionization detection (PID) for volatile organic compounds (VOCs) including formaldehyde, ethylene oxide, and benzene derivatives. This multi-principle architecture ensures broad-spectrum coverage while maintaining analytical specificity and minimizing cross-sensitivity—critical for environmental screening, industrial hygiene assessments, and emergency response scenarios where rapid identification and concentration estimation are mission-critical.

Sample Compatibility & Compliance
The GHK-4300B is validated for direct analysis of undiluted ambient air samples under ISO 16000-23 (indoor air VOC measurement), OSHA 29 CFR 1910.120 (HAZWOPER), and EPA Method TO-15/TO-17 prerequisites for field screening. Sensor modules comply with IEC 61508 SIL 2 functional safety requirements for gas detection systems. The instrument housing meets IP67 ingress protection (dust-tight and submersible to 1 m for 30 min), and its intrinsic safety design conforms to ATEX II 2G Ex ib IIC T4 Gb and UL 913 Class I, Division 1, Groups A–D standards when configured with certified explosion-proof sensor options. All firmware and calibration logs maintain audit-ready timestamps and user ID tagging for GLP/GMP-aligned workflows.
Software & Data Management
Data acquisition and configuration are managed via the embedded GHK-Link firmware v4.2, supporting time-stamped logging at user-selectable intervals (1 s to 24 h). Measurement records include raw sensor outputs, compensated values, environmental parameters, GPS coordinates (when external GNSS module connected), and operator ID. Data export is performed via standard USB 2.0 interface to FAT32-formatted USB drives; files are saved in CSV format with UTF-8 encoding and header metadata compliant with ASTM D7416-22 data interchange specifications. Optional PC software (GHK-DataSuite v3.1) enables trend visualization, statistical summary (min/max/avg/stdev), report generation (PDF/Excel), and calibration certificate archiving with digital signature support aligned with FDA 21 CFR Part 11 requirements.

FAQ
What gases can the GHK-4300B detect out of the box?
The base configuration includes sensors for O₂, CO, H₂S, and combustible gas (LEL); all other gases—including VOCs, NO₂, SO₂, Cl₂, NH₃, O₃, HF, HCN, and CO₂—are available as optional plug-in modules selected at time of order.
Is factory calibration traceable to national standards?
Yes—each sensor module undergoes individual calibration using certified gas standards traceable to NIST (USA) or NIM (China), with calibration certificates issued per ISO/IEC 17025 requirements.
Can the instrument be used in explosive atmospheres?
When equipped with ATEX/UL-certified sensor variants and operated within specified temperature class limits (T4), the GHK-4300B is approved for use in Zone 1/Division 1 hazardous locations.
How is data integrity ensured during long-term logging?
All stored records contain cyclic redundancy check (CRC-32) checksums, write-protection flags, and immutable timestamps generated by a hardware real-time clock with battery backup.
Does the device support remote data transmission?
The standard model does not include cellular or Wi-Fi connectivity; however, optional RS-485 Modbus RTU and Bluetooth 5.0 interfaces enable integration into SCADA networks or mobile reporting via companion Android/iOS apps.
